Xu Deshuai was born on 13 January 1987 in Dalian, China. He currently plays as a midfielder for Sun Pegasus in the Hong Kong First Division League.
Xu began playing football at his hometown side Dilian Shide. In 2004, he was promoted to the first team of the club but spent the whole season warming the bench as an unused substitute. In 2005, the club’s management sent Deshuai on loan to Citizen and his career really took off there. The midfielder made 31 solid appearances during a three-year stint on loan, and the club decided to sign Deshuai on a permanent deal in 2008. He scored his first and second senior career goal in a game against Hong Kong Sheffield United in May 2009. The string of his terrific performances, 7 goals in 23 appearances, earned Deshuai the Hong Kong Top Footballers of the Year title in 2009.
In the 2010/11 season, Xu Deshuai was snapped up by Hong Kong giants South China where he played for two years. He pulled off his debut season with the club as the Hong Kong League Cup and FA Cup winner. In 2012, Xu Deshuai signed for Sun Pegasus and plays for the club till today.
Since 2005 till 2006, Xu Deshuai earned 3 caps to the China U19 team. Since 2008, he is capped to the Hong Kong national team.
